Abstract | There is little extant theory framing the role of isolation in predicting various outcomes relating to the quality of work life of school principals. Building on previous work, this paper examines the relationships between isolation, self-efficacy, job satisfaction, burnout, and intention to leave the job using structural equation modeling on a sample of first-year principals from a Southeastern US state. Results affirm the import of isolation as an antecedent of each outcome, in particular principals' sense of efficacy. (As Provided). |
